STEM Insecticides 12 fl. oz. is a fast-acting, plant-based bug spray scientifically formulated to kill ants, roaches, and flies. Safe for use around people and pets when used as directed, it features a fresh botanical scent without harsh chemicals or added fragrances. Tested by entomologists and suitable for both indoor and outdoor use, STEM offers a natural yet powerful pest control solution trusted by thousands.

I was away for 5 days and the power went out. Circuit breaker tripped. Swarms of fruit flies, biblical plague-level infestation. I sprayed this on the flies, on the windows, in the fridge, and in the freezer after I dumped all the groceries. (In this economy that killed me) This spray massacred the flies, instantly. It's oil-based, so flies walking on it are dooooomed. Wash sprayed surfaces with dish detergent. The smell is tolerable, not really chemical. A cross between citronella and bergamot. 10/10 reccomend.
